Understanding Lowboy Flatbed Trailers
Lowboy flatbed trailers are designed for transporting heavy equipment and oversized loads. Their unique structure, characterized by a lower deck height, allows for the safe and efficient transport of tall and heavy machinery that would otherwise exceed height restrictions on standard trailers.
Key Features of Lowboy Flatbed Trailers
- Low Deck Height: The primary feature that distinguishes lowboy trailers is their low deck height, which facilitates the transportation of taller loads without exceeding legal height limits.
- Robust Construction: Built to withstand heavy loads, these trailers are constructed from high-strength materials, ensuring durability and longevity.
- Versatile Loading Options: Many lowboy trailers come equipped with ramps or detachable necks, allowing for easy loading and unloading of equipment.
- Enhanced Stability: The design of lowboy trailers provides a lower center of gravity, enhancing stability during transport, which is crucial for safety.

Choosing the Right Lowboy Flatbed Trailer
When selecting a lowboy flatbed trailer, several factors should be considered to ensure it meets your specific needs:
1. Load Capacity
Evaluate the maximum load capacity required for your operations. Lowboy trailers come in various capacities, so it’s essential to choose one that aligns with your transport needs.
2. Trailer Length
The length of the trailer can impact its maneuverability and the types of loads it can carry. Consider the dimensions of the equipment you plan to transport.
3. Material and Build Quality
